Composite veneers use a tooth-coloured resin (composite) that is applied directly to the front of the teeth and sculpted by the dentist to improve their shape, colour and surface. Unlike porcelain veneers, which are made in a laboratory, composite veneers are usually built up chairside in a single appointment, and often require little or no removal of natural enamel — which makes them a more conservative and reversible option, as well as a more affordable one. At Pro Medical Clinic Dent, composite veneers can be used to mask discolouration, repair chipped or worn edges, close small gaps and harmonise the shape of the front teeth. The clinic also offers a flow-injection technique, in which a clear template guides flowable composite onto the teeth for precise, even and reproducible results — useful when several teeth are being treated together. The composite is layered, cured and then polished to a natural finish. Composite veneers suit adults wanting to enhance the appearance of their smile at a lower cost than porcelain, or who prefer a less invasive approach. They can chip or stain over time and may need occasional repair or repolishing, which the dentist will explain alongside the porcelain alternative so you can weigh longevity against cost. As with all cosmetic dental work, healthy teeth and gums are needed, and suitability is confirmed at consultation.
